Climbing the Copilot Mountain: How we help you turn AI vision into action

Standing at the foot of the Copilot mountain is a familiar sight for many partners.
A landscape full of opportunity, combined with complexity. Questions about strategy, adoption, sales activation, governance, change and delivery often form the fog that keeps the summit out of view. Many partners recognize Copilot’s potential, yet few know how to turn it into real business growth.

At TD SYNNEX, we saw the same patterns returning across our ecosystem:

  • No unified GenAI or Copilot approach
  • Too much focus on technology without a clear change and adoption plan
  • Unclear positioning within existing service portfolios
  • Consultants eager to deliver but lacking hands-on experience
  • Leadership teams wanting results but missing a structured roadmap

To solve this, TD SYNNEX partnered with Frank Vanhamel (Art of Inspiration) and Microsoft to create The Mountain of Copilot. It is a structured journey that transforms Copilot confusion into clarity, and clarity into measurable business impact.

Successful AI adoption relies on three pillars:
  1. Strategy: Clear positioning, packaged services and a go-to-market motion that combines technology with change management.
  2. Enablement: Consultants with deep Copilot knowledge who can translate ideas into real customer scenarios.
  3. Execution: A commercial engine that generates pipeline and closes Copilot deals.

The Mountain of Copilot is built around these three pillars.

TRACK 1:

Building Your Copilot Go To Market Strategy

Partners often ask: How do we integrate Copilot into our offering without reinventing our entire business? Track 1 guides participants through building a complete and aligned Copilot Go To Market strategy.

Workshop Breakdown
  • Workshop 1: Kick off (27th February)
    Introduction to the full journey and Copilot inspiration.
  • Workshop 2: GTM Technology (20th March)
    Inspiration and guided development of a technology-focused Go To Market strategy.
  • Workshop 3: GTM People and Change (3rd April)
    Adding Prosci and ADKAR based change enablement to ensure sustainable customer adoption.
Outcome

By the end of Track 1, partners have:

  • A complete Copilot Go To Market strategy
  • Alignment between sales, pre sales and delivery
  • A commercial motion that is ready to generate pipeline
  • Access to co-sell support from TD SYNNEX and Microsoft to close initial Copilot deals

TRACK 2:

Copilot and Copilot Studio Deep Dive

While leaders and sales teams focus on strategy, delivery teams build capability. Track 2 transforms consultants into confident Copilot specialists.

Workshop Breakdown
  • Deep Dive M365 Copilot plus Change and Adoption (24th April)
    Hands-on learning of M365 Copilot, governance, agent types and adoption frameworks.
  • Deep Dive Copilot Studio and Build Your Own Agent (19th May)
    A practical day where consultants build real agents, such as CRM agents, and learn about licensing, credits and integration options.
Outcome

Your delivery team will be able to:

  • Implement M365 Copilot in customer environments
  • Build and deploy Copilot Studio agents
  • Translate customer workflows into AI powered automation

Together, Track 1 and Track 2 form a complete path from strategy to execution.
